The U.S. stopped printing the $1,000 bill and larger denominations by 1946, but these bills continued circulating until the Federal Reserve decided to recall them in 1969, Forgue said. As of 2009, only 165,000 $1,000 bills were known to remain. The Treasury stopped printing the larger notes in 1945, but most continued to circulate until 1969 when the Federal Reserve began destroying those that were received by banks. The face of the 1918 thousand dollar bill has relatively minimal decoration, or adornment, and extensive white space. The 1918 note features a bald eagle clutching several symbolic objects, including an American flag. Nearly 100 years later, the U.S. government brought back the 1,000 dollar bill to support Civil War efforts and fund major war-related purchases.
